Board Packets For Members?
QUESTION:  Do owners have the right to board packets so they can follow along during the meeting?

ANSWER: The Open Meeting Act gives owners the right to meeting agendas but not to to board packets. Information distributed to the board of directors frequently consists of member correspondence, bid proposals, personnel issues, delinquencies, etc., all of which are protected under various privacy rights and executive session privileges.
